The Advantage of a Park Environment
Although it's a private chalet, it's located on a holiday park with a range of shared facilities. Guests enjoy a private beach on Lake Veluwe, making the waterfront location (or within walking distance) even more appealing to water sports enthusiasts. The presence of sports fields, playgrounds, and canoe and SUP rental facilities gives the experience a "light resort" feel. This offers a compromise: the privacy of a private chalet combined with the comforts and recreational opportunities typically associated with a larger resort or a complex of multiple apartments .
The Critical Drawbacks and Limitations
Despite the perfect 5.0-star rating, it's crucial for an objective review to highlight its limitations. The biggest potential drawback lies in the sample size: the perfect score is based on only two reviews. While these two guests were very satisfied, this offers a limited perspective on the long-term experience or the variation in the various accommodations within the park. A hospedaje with hundreds of reviews offers more certainty.
In addition, there are the specific operational restrictions of the park itself, Vakantiepark Familiehuis Nunspeet. The park's Christian orientation requires strict adherence to the "Sunday Rest." This means that the reception is closed on Sundays, and check-in and check-out are not possible. For guests who require flexibility in their travel dates, or who are accustomed to the 24/7 service of larger hotels or some commercial resort complexes, this can be an unacceptable obstacle to their accommodation planning.
Strict Terms of Use
Another serious restriction, immediately apparent from the sales information, is the prohibition on permanent occupancy. This specific type of Alojamiento is strictly for recreational use. While this makes sense for a holiday park, potential renters should consider this if they are looking for a long-term accommodation that might be closer to a regular apartment or house. While there are indications that some chalets are pet-friendly, park regulations generally indicate pet restrictions, which is a point of attention for pet owners looking for a chalet.
